Why Hard Water Makes Lathering Soap a Horror

Before we plunge into the best soaps for hard water, let’s first comprehend why it presents such a challenge. Hard water contains an excess of minerals like calcium and magnesium. When these minerals react with the parts of soap, it forms a viscous scum that doesn’t rinse away readily. As a result, you end up with soap residue on your skin and hair, making them feel dull and coated.

The Versatility of Castile Soap and Detergent-Based Soaps

For those looking for specific solutions to combat hard water, castile soap and detergent-based products should be on your radar. Castile soap is made from pure vegetable oils and is recognized for its mildness and gentleness on the skin. It effectively removes mineral deposits that form as a film on your hair and skin, preventing them from redepositing over time. Detergent-based products, on the other hand, contain components like Ethylenediaminetetraacetic acid (EDTA) that bind with minerals, removing them from your skin and hair. These components can commonly be found in various brands of shampoo and bath products. So whether you prefer the natural qualities of castile soap or the power of detergents, both options provide effective solutions to tackle hard water.
